Plan de ejecución
- Validate demand by running a 2–4 week pre-launch promo and measuring conversion by neighborhood in Naucalpan.
- Define a tight, margin-led menu (best-sellers + limited specials) and standardize recipes to control food cost and consistency.
- Differentiate with local brand positioning: delivery speed, consistent crust quality, and recognizable signature items.
- Track unit economics weekly (food cost %, labor %, average ticket, order volume) and adjust staffing and prep schedules to protect profit.
- Build a repeat engine with loyalty offers and targeted WhatsApp/SMS campaigns for nearby residents and offices.
- Plan for break-even sensitivity: set a conservative cash buffer and establish discount caps so revenue dips don’t stall recovery.
